Job description

CVS myPBM Clinical is seeking hands-on, passionate professionals to join a high-energy team dedicated to making a meaningful impact in the technology space. We are currently looking for a highly skilled, full stack Senior Software Engineer to join a team responsible for building software components on a cutting-edge, cloud-native platform hosted on Azure Kubernetes.

In this role, you will play a critical part in designing and developing microservices that drive the modernization of the clinical domain. The ideal candidate brings deep experience in backend and frontend development, system design, and a strong understanding of cloud-native software engineering principles.

As part of a team of dedicated software engineers, you will work on applications and products at the forefront of technology, contributing to scalable, resilient solutions that support critical clinical and business capabilities.

This role requires someone to work a hybrid (remote + office) schedule from one of our technical offices in either Buffalo Grove, IL or Richardson, TX

Expectations for the Role

  • Establish and implement processes to streamline software development and ensure adherence to best practices.
  • Design and develop complex software systems to meet business requirements and optimize performance.
  • Assess project requirements and deliver projects on time and within budget.
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ams to ensure effective communication and alignment of software development efforts with overall project goals and timelines.
  • Ensure compliance with industry standards and best practices to maintain the quality and security of software products.
  • Integrate applications with cloud-native services such as managed databases.
  • Implement security measures and best practices for cloud deployments.
  • Optimize applications for cloud environments to maximize cost-efficiency and resource utilization.
  • Build and integrate APIs (both GraphQL and REST) for scalable service communication.
  • Deploy and manage services on Azure Kubernetes.
  • Automate CI/CD pipelines using GitHub Actions.

Requirements

  • 5+ years of software development experience with specific development experience in Back End technologies such as Java and Spring Boot.
  • 2+ years working with APIs (GraphQL and REST) in microservices architectures
  • 2+ years hands-on experience with Azure
  • 2+ years hands-on experience with Angular
  • 2+ years of experience with databases (Oracle)
  • 2+ years' experience with CI/CD tools (GitHub Actions, Jenkins, or similar), * Experience working with pub/sub tools like Kafka or similar
  • Hands-on experience with Azure Kubernetes
  • Familiarity with Kubernetes concepts
  • Strong understanding of microservice best practices and distributed systems
  • Healthcare domain experience preferred, Bachelor's degree or equivalent experience
